New curtains or blinds

In the spring, the dark heavy curtains that have kept the heat in just don’t work. Swap them out for light breezy curtains that let in lots of natural light in the summer months. 

Curtains and blinds let you introduce some gorgeous, patterned fabrics into your home, and you can change them to match the season – bold florals are wonderful for the spring. If you have a neutral home, just the introduction of a bit of pattern on a Roman blind can be all you need to lift a room from bland to beautiful. Using an interior design to help you choose fabrics and get your curtains and blinds professionally made is a wise investment.

Reupholster tired furniture

Spring is the best time to revamp old furniture. Upholstering tired furniture is a sure way to transform an old piece and give a new look to a much-loved heirloom. Again, this is the time to choose a dramatic fabric with personality to make a real statement.

Go maximalist

After years of minimalism, it’s time to decorate your home to the max, living with things that give you pleasure and make you happy! Maximalism is a huge trend for 2023 but don’t worry, it’s not all clashing prints and bright colours – it’s more about expressing your personality and creative flair through your choice of colour, pattern and accessories. Layering, texture and toning colours will create a space that is stylish yet comfortable to live in.

Showcase treasured ornaments such as beautiful glasses or eccentric trinkets in a cabinet or cluster collections on bookshelves, trays, along mantlepieces or on top of coffee tables.

Done well, maximalism creates a home that lifts our spirits and promotes positive feelings. We all need that nowadays!

Get wallpapering!

Wallpaper adds instant style to your home and is really on trend in 2023. Paper a whole room, an accent wall or some panelling. From traditional florals to contemporary geometrics and tropical botanicals or animal motifs, there is something for everyone. 

Floral wallpaper works with any decorative style – whether it’s vintage, retro or contemporary. Geometric prints give instant art deco glamour to bedrooms and bathrooms and nature-inspired papers will inject nature into your home all year round and instil a sense of serenity and calm.
